About The Position

The Workflow Engineer will play a critical role in designing, implementing, and optimizing complex business processes to achieve operational efficiency and effectiveness. This position requires a combination of technical skills, business acumen, and a deep understanding of workflow systems. The workflow engineer is a subject matter expert and will work with business stakeholders to implement, create, and continuously improve process and integration with other internal business applications through JIRA service management with automation.

Requirements

  • 1+ years experience with Jira.
  • Proven experience in workflow design and implementation, preferably in a similar industry.
  • Proficiency in workflow software, such as JSM, PowerAutomate, Salesforce, Fabric.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to identify and resolve complex workflow issues.
  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al, with the ability to clearly convey technical information to non-technical stakeholders.
  • Experience with JIRA integrations, such as plug-ins, APIs, and webhooks.

Nice To Haves

  • Languages: JQL, Python, Java.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and implement efficient business process workflows in line with organizational goals.
  • Map out current processes, identify bottlenecks or inefficiencies, and design optimized workflows in JIRA service management.
  • Work closely with various cross-functional teams, including IT, operations, and management, to understand their workflow needs and challenges.
  • Provide necessary training and support to end-users to ensure smooth adoption and operation of new workflow systems.
  • Continually monitor and analyze the effectiveness of implemented workflows, adjusting and improving as necessary.
  • Document all processes, updates, and changes to workflow systems and ensure these documents are easily accessible and understandable to relevant teams.
  • Implement and integrate workflow triggers from various APIs, plug-ins, and webhooks.
